How to Implement an Effective Electrical Safety Training Program

Electrical safety training is an essential part of any workplace safety program. Electrical accidents can cause serious injury or even death, so it is important to ensure that all employees are properly trained in electrical safety. Here are some tips for implementing an effective electrical safety training program.

1. Develop a comprehensive electrical safety policy. This policy should include information on the types of electrical hazards that may be present in the workplace, the safety measures that must be taken to protect employees, and the consequences for not following safety protocols.

2. Provide employees with the necessary safety equipment. This includes items such as insulated gloves, face shields, and other protective gear. Make sure that all employees are aware of the proper use of this equipment and that it is regularly inspected and maintained.

3. Educate employees on the dangers of electricity. This includes information on the types of electrical hazards, the effects of electricity on the body, and the proper safety procedures to follow when working with electricity.

4. Provide hands-on training. This can include demonstrations of proper safety procedures, such as how to properly ground electrical equipment and how to safely disconnect power sources.

5. Conduct regular safety inspections. These inspections should be conducted by a qualified professional and should include a review of the electrical safety policy, the safety equipment, and the safety procedures that are in place.

6. Monitor employee compliance with safety protocols. Make sure that employees are following the safety protocols that have been established and that any violations are addressed immediately.

By following these tips, you can ensure that your workplace is safe and that your employees are properly trained in electrical safety. Implementing an effective electrical safety training program is essential for protecting your employees and your business.
